The World Bank is helping to fight poverty and improve the living standards for the people in Mali.  As of March 2007, the World Bank had approved a total of 89 IDA credits for Mali for a total amount of approximately US$1.9 billion. The commitment value of 13 ongoing IDA-financed operations is roughly US$542.3 million  with an undisbursed balance of US$331.8 million.
